As verbs, bamboozle and play false are synonyms defined as:
  • bamboozle and play false: conceal one's true motives from especially by elaborately feigning good intentions so as to gain an end
Other synonyms of bamboozle include hoodwink, lead by the nose, pull the wool over someone's eyes, snow.
